There's a reason for the price difference, other than MHz.  The DKB boards needed a firmware update to run OS3.1.  So with the Cobra, unless you are lucky to find one with the update, will have you stuck in OS3.0.  Then you'd need to figure out some clever way of soft-kicking into 3.1 so you could install 3.9.  I've never done it, maybe someone here has found a way?  My advice, bite the bullet and get a Blizzard MarkIV (or better yet a Blizz1260).  btw, since BlizzardPPCs with 68060s seem to be fetching only around $350-400US right now on eBay, you might want to bite a little harder, pay roughly double what you'd pay for a 68030 and have a real monster A1200 (provided your not limiting yourself to just an A1200 desktop original).
